General Guidelines

General Guidelines are the foundation of any successful retail store cleaning routine. To ensure a clean and healthy environment for both customers and employees, it’s important to set some basic rules.

Firstly, establish a daily cleaning schedule that includes tasks such as sweeping floors, wiping down surfaces, and restocking supplies. Make sure each team member knows their responsibilities and is held accountable for completing them.

Another important guideline to follow is the use of non-toxic cleaning products wherever possible. This not only benefits employee health but also reduces environmental impact.

Regular equipment maintenance should also be scheduled to avoid breakdowns or malfunctions which could lead to inefficiencies in your cleaning process.

Consider hiring professional cleaners periodically for deep cleaning or more complex tasks like carpet shampooing or window washing.

By following these general guidelines, you can maintain a consistently clean retail space while keeping your employees safe and happy.

Floor Care

Floor Care is an essential aspect of maintaining a clean and hygienic retail store. Dirty floors not only look unprofessional but can also pose safety hazards to employees and customers. Therefore, it is crucial to have a proper floor care routine in place.

The first step towards ensuring that your floors are spotless is by implementing daily sweeping or vacuuming. This helps remove dirt, debris, and dust that accumulate on the surface throughout the day. Additionally, if spills occur during business hours, they should be addressed immediately to avoid stains or slip-and-fall incidents.

Another important aspect of floor care is regular mopping or scrubbing with appropriate cleaning agents suitable for your type of flooring material. A deep clean every few weeks can help eliminate stubborn stains and grime buildup that may not come off with regular cleaning.

Make sure you’re taking preventative measures too! Place mats at entryways to trap dirt before entering the store and consider applying sealants to protect against future damage.

By following these simple steps for floor care regularly will keep your store looking pristine while providing clients with a safe shopping environment!

Glass & Mirrors

When it comes to retail store cleaning, the importance of clean and spotless glass and mirrors cannot be overstated. These surfaces can easily accumulate smudges, fingerprints, dust, and dirt, which can detract from the overall appearance of your store. To maintain a professional look that reflects positively on your brand image, regular cleaning is essential.

To start with glass surfaces such as windows or display cases should be wiped down daily using microfiber cloths or squeegees to get rid of any grime or streaks. For stubborn stains or marks, one could use a safe non-toxic commercial cleaner specifically designed for glass.

Mirrors require more attention than just wiping them down with a cloth as they tend to fog up quickly, especially during peak hours when there’s high traffic in-store. It’s best to use an ammonia-based solution mixed with water in equal parts sprayed onto the mirror surface before polishing it dry either by hand using a microfiber cloth or through mechanical means like buffing machines.

Regular maintenance of these surfaces ensures customers are able to see products clearly without being distracted by unsightly smudges while also creating an inviting atmosphere that encourages buyers into making purchases.

Furniture Care

Taking good care of a store’s furniture is important for both its aesthetics and its longevity. Cleaning your furniture on a regular basis will help keep it free of allergens, dust, and stains.

Care for the furniture in your store should begin with a thorough inventory of each piece’s material composition. To prevent discoloration or damage, different varieties need unique cleaning techniques.

Dust should be removed from wood furniture on a regular basis by wiping it with a damp cloth. Scratches can easily be left behind by utilizing harsh chemicals or abrasive materials, so try to stay away from those. To maintain the wood looking its best, you can also polish it on occasion.

Rust can be avoided on metal furniture by wiping it off with a damp cloth dipped in a mild soap solution and then drying it off right away.

Regular cleaning with a brush attachment of upholstered furniture like couches is necessary to remove crumbs and other dirt from deep within the upholstery’s folds and creases. Spot treatment should be used in the event of spills or stains on materials like polyester or leatherette to prevent the markings from setting in.

Keep in mind that different surfaces require different maintenance. A well-maintained display will attract clients and last longer, avoiding costly repairs down the road.

General Cleaning Supplies

When it comes to maintaining a clean and hygienic retail store, having the right cleaning supplies is crucial. Here are some essential general cleaning supplies that should be on your checklist:

Firstly, you’ll need surface cleaners such as all-purpose sprays for wiping down counters, tables, and other surfaces. Make sure to choose a product that is safe for the materials in your store.

Secondly, don’t forget about disinfectants! These are important for killing germs and preventing the spread of illnesses. Be sure to use disinfectant wipes or sprays on high-touch areas such as door handles, shopping carts, and payment terminals.

Thirdly, stock up on trash bags and recycling bins so you can dispose of waste properly. Keeping your store free from clutter will help create an inviting atmosphere for customers.

Have plenty of microfiber cloths on hand. They’re perfect for dusting shelves and displays without leaving behind streaks or scratches.

By keeping these general cleaning supplies stocked up at all times, you’ll be able to maintain a clean retail space that’s both welcoming and safe for everyone who enters it.
